#9de0f2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9de0f2 is composed of 61.6% red, 87.8%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 7.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 192.7 degrees, a saturation of 76.6% and a lightness of 78.2%. #9de0f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3bc1e5.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#9de0f2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9de0f2 has RGB values of R:157, G:224,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 10346738.

Hex triplet 9de0f2 #9de0f2
RGB Decimal 157, 224, 242 rgb(157,224,242)
RGB Percent 61.6, 87.8, 94.9 rgb(61.6%,87.8%,94.9%)
CMYK 35, 7, 0, 5
HSL 192.7°, 76.6, 78.2 hsl(192.7,76.6%,78.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 192.7°, 35.1, 94.9
Web Safe 99ccff #99ccff
CIE-LAB 85.447, -16.655, -15.48
XYZ 56.583, 66.888, 93.929
xyY 0.26, 0.308, 66.888
CIE-LCH 85.447, 22.739, 222.906
CIE-LUV 85.447, -32.376, -21.833
Hunter-Lab 81.785, -19.627, -10.844
Binary 10011101, 11100000, 11110010

Shades and Tints of #9de0f2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9de0f2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3cacc is the less saturated color, while #90e7ff is the most saturated one.
